when using SMTP for autosupports, one can add additional e-mail addresses which will also receive the SMTP notifications and we're using this feature to collect autosupports in one of our support mailboxes. If we'd want to move away from SMTP, how could we do that in the future? When we switch to the https transport method, the autosupports most likely will only be posted to NetApp, I suppose. Am I overlooking something or is there really no way to specify an additional URL or something like this so that we can also receive these alerts then? Ideally, I'd either like to run the autosupport receiver locally on our infrastructue and forward the requests to NetApp then. This way, I could parse the requests and (if necessary) create tickets, etc. and archive them internally.
Anyone ever worked on something like this or knows where I can find more information about that?
